Application of PET-TPU composite film

To understand PET-TPU composite film, we must first know what is PET release film.

The PET release film is based on the PET film and coated with a layer of methyl silicone oil on its surface to reduce the surface adhesion of the PET film (in other words, it can prevent sticking)

PET film with base film has the following characteristics: 1. Low cost; 2. Easy to produce and process; 3. Environmentally friendly, non-toxic and tasteless; 4. Good tensile strength.

The PET-TPU composite film is made by compounding the PET release film on the surface of the TPU film by pressing and winding processes, so the TPU composite film takes into account the advantages of TPU and PET. The PET-TPU composite film protects theTPU film from being stretched during processing.

PET film is a kind of release film, which can play the following five functions in composite TPU film.

1.1 Surface. PET-TPU composite film is cleaner;

2. PET-TPU composite film is smoother;

3. When used for printing, it will not be deformed or stained;

4. It is easier to handle.

5. Good tensile strength

The role of PET in the PET-TPU composite film is to make the surface of the TPU film cleaner! When printing TPU film, PET release film protects it from deformation and keeps its surface clean to prevent it from being contaminated. In order to prevent the TPU film from sticking back, one side of the PET release film has an anti-sticking function, so it will not stick together when rolled up.

TPU hot melt adhesive film vs anaerobic adhesive: "Scene flexibility" difference in automotive interior bonding
2025-09-11
​From the perspective of curing conditions, TPU hot melt adhesive film does not need to rely on special environments, while anaerobic adhesives are severely restricted by "auerobicity". The curing principle of anaerobic glue is to undergo polymerization under conditions of lack of oxygen and catalyzed by metal ions (such as iron and copper). If it is in an environment where air circulation or metal substrates are not available, the curing speed will be greatly slowed down or even unable to cure. In automotive interiors, most bonding scenarios are "open" (such as bonding the door panel skin to PP substrate, and the ceiling fabric to the sponge), the air can freely contact the bonding surface, and the substrate is mostly non-metallic (PP, ABS, fabric, etc.), lacking metal ion catalysis, and additional catalyst is required when using anaerobic glue, and the curing time is as long as several hours, which is difficult to meet the needs of industrial production. The TPU hot melt adhesive film only needs to be melted by heating (120-160℃) and can be cured after pressurization and cooling. It does not need to rely on the ambient oxygen concentration or the base material. It can be cured stably in open or closed bonding scenarios, and the curing time only takes a few dozen seconds to a few minutes, adapting to the fast-paced needs of the interior production line.
